What is Hard Water?
Difficult water is characterized by its mineral web content, specifically calcium and magnesium ions. These minerals go into the supply of water as it percolates through sedimentary rock and chalk down payments underground. When tough water is heated or left to stand, it tends to develop range, a crusty buildup that abides by surfaces and can cause a series of issues in pipes systems.

Water Softeners
Water conditioners are the most usual remedy for dealing with tough water. They work by exchanging calcium and magnesium ions with salt or potassium ions, effectively reducing the solidity of the water.

Flush Your Water Heater Regularly
Hard water can cause sediment buildup in your water heater, reducing its efficiency and potentially causing damage. We recommend flushing your water heater at least once a year to remove sediment and maintain optimal performance.
